You conduct a reaction in a calorimeter, with a thermometer inserted to gauge the temperature of the solution in which the reaction occurs. The thermometer reading increases from 295K to 301K as the reaction proceeds. What is the sign of the change in enthalpy for the reaction?

Negative

Out of three photons with wavelengths of 413nm, 688nm, and 532nm, which has the highest energy? Which has the highest frequency?

Highest energy: 413nm

Highest frequency: 413nm

How many electrons can be in the 4d subshell? How many orbitals are in the 4d subshell?

Electrons: 10e-

Orbitals: 5

What are the five intermolecular forces in order of strongest to weakest?

ion-ion

ion-dipole

dipole-dipole

H-bonding (sub-category of dipole-dipole)

London dispersion forces

What are examples of each intermolecular force?

ion-ion: NaCl

ion-dipole: H2O with Na+ and Cl-

dipole-dipole: H2O molecules

H-bonding: H2O molecules

London-dispersion: H2 molecules

What do each of the four quantum numbers, n, l, ml and ms represent?

n: size and energy

l: shape

ml: orbital orientation(s)

ms: electron spin

A 55.0g piece of iron at 425°C (CFe = 0.499 J/g*°C) is dropped into 600.0g water (CH2O = 4.184 J/g*°C) at 25°C. The iron and the water will both reach the same final temperature. What is that final temperature? (Hint: the iron loses as much heat as the water gains)

29°C

As intermolecular forces increase in strength, what happens to the following parameters? (increase/decrease)

Boiling point

Melting Point

Surface tension

Viscosity

Vapor pressure

Boiling point: increase

Melting Point: increase

Surface tension: increase

Viscosity: increase

Vapor pressure: decrease
